Transaction 186383cf28e12c7a617bc713c830df5e4ac2a1d2d4dcd8169fd23f42262b76ec
1 Input
1 Output
-
186383cf28e12c7a617bc713c830df5e4ac2a1d2d4dcd8169fd23f42262b76ec:0
- value
- 2142476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00c285288c5ede36b4862c6b85dc5052a1e7193e OP_EQUAL
- address
- 31m2x3KDse1jc9e71AcWiqojN5HsP1FAQX